Technical Problem

Water spraying can easily splash and flow in glass grinding rollers, affecting the normal grinding operation of glass plates.

Method used

A glass grinding roller machine was designed. A servo motor-driven displacement component drives the grinding roller to rotate, and water is sprayed onto the grinding area through a water spraying component. The sprayed water is blocked by a baffle and collected in a water receiving component. After being filtered through a filter screen, the water is discharged. The stability of the glass plate is improved by combining rubber wheels and locking screws.

Benefits of technology

This effectively prevents the flow of sprayed water, improves the stability and convenience of glass grinding, and ensures the smooth progress of glass processing.

Abstract

The utility model relates to the technical field of glass processing, and discloses a roller grinding machine for glass processing, which comprises a platform, the top of the platform is provided with a pressing piece and a limiting piece, glass is placed in a placing groove, then the left end of the glass is pressed, then a servo motor operates to drive a lead screw to rotate, then a displacement piece is made to displace, and the glass is placed in the placing groove. Meanwhile, a driving motor operates to drive a grinding roller to rotate to grind the right side edge of the glass plate, meanwhile, a water spraying head of a water spraying part sprays water to the grinding position to be matched with the grinding roller for grinding, and a blocking film shields the two sides of a displacement part at the moment, so that sprayed water flows to a water receiving part after being blocked by the blocking film and then enters a bottom-reaching part; and through cooperation with road network filtering, the water is discharged from a water discharging pipe, so that the sprayed water is shielded and collected, the situation that the sprayed water flows everywhere is avoided, sand blasting water with powder is conveniently collected and then subjected to follow-up treatment, and the use convenience of the roller grinding machine for glass processing is improved.

TECHNICAL FIELD

[0001] The utility model relates to glass processing technical field, concretely is a kind of grinding roller machine for glass processing. BACKGROUND

[0002] Glass processing is the process of raw glass through cutting, edging, punching, carving and other process treatments to meet different application requirements. This process not only requires precise technology, but also requires a deep understanding of glass properties. In the construction industry, processed glass can be used for window, curtain wall and other building decorations, while in the furniture industry, it is often used for table top and cabinet door, etc. Grinding roller machine is an important equipment in glass processing, mainly used for grinding and polishing the surface and sidewall of glass. It removes impurities and burrs on the surface of glass through the friction between the rotating grinding roller and the glass, making it smooth and flat.

[0003] The existing grinding roller machine for glass processing is usually driven by a motor to rotate the polishing roller to polish the sidewall of the glass plate fixed on the platform. Water is usually sprayed on the polishing area to help polishing and remove powder. However, when the water is sprayed on the joint between the polishing roller and the glass plate, it is easy to be splashed by the rotating polishing roller, and then it is easy to flow everywhere, affecting the normal polishing operation of the glass plate. Therefore, we propose a grinding roller machine for glass processing. UTILITY MODEL CONTENT

[0004] The utility model aims at providing a grinding roller machine for glass processing to solve the problem of water flowing everywhere affecting the polishing of glass plate as mentioned in the background.

[0030] Working principle: through the glass is placed in the placing groove 120 after rotating the locking screw one 111 makes the lower pressing piece 110 cooperate with the pressing plate 112 to the left end of the glass is pressed, and then servo motor 152 runs drives the lead screw 153 rotates after making the displacement piece 154 displacement, drive motor 155 runs drives the polishing roller 156 rotation realizes the right side of the glass plate is polished, at the same time, the water spraying head 172 of the water spraying piece 170 is against the polishing place and sprays water and cooperates with the polishing roller 156 to polish, at this time, the film 160 is blocked on both sides of the displacement piece 154, so that the sprayed water is blocked by the film 160 and flows to the water receiving piece 157 and then enters the bottom piece 180, cooperates with the road network filter and is discharged from the drain pipe 181, so as to realize the blocking and collecting of the sprayed water, avoid the sprayed water from flowing everywhere, facilitate the collection of the sandblasting water with powder for subsequent treatment, increase the convenience of the glass processing grinding roller machine in use; after the glass plate is placed in the placing groove 120, the clamping piece 142 of the pressing piece 140 can be pushed to the right in cooperation with the limiting piece 130, at this time, the rubber wheel 141 is tightly attached to the top of the glass plate and rolls to the right, and then the locking screw two 131 is used to lock the clamping piece 142, at this time, the pressing piece 140 presses the top of the glass plate, so that the glass plate is placed more stably during side edge polishing, avoiding the glass plate from shaking during polishing, and improving the stability of the device during operation.
